It was some 30 years ago when we hitchhiked from Cairo to Assuan. We did
not have a Sudanese visa when we tried to board the ferry boat to Wadi
Halfa. They refused to let us aboard - and **** there was n o Sudanese
consulate in Assuan, so we had to go back all the way to Cairo. In Cairo
on the Sudanese Embassy they first wanted to see the Ethiopian visa before we finally received the Sudanese visa, what a hassle. And then
up the Nile again.
